In addition to using the individual rebalance, bulk rebalance, and no change review features in Portfolio Cloud, you can also manually upload recommendations and trades into your projects.
You can upload recommendations into both standard and review projects. For more information on the different types of advice workflows available in each project, please refer to the Advice Workflows section of the user guide.
Manual recommendation uploads are useful when the rebalancing or trade generation is done outside of the Portfolio Cloud system. Common examples include IPOs, new unlisted investments, or corporate actions such as dividend reinvestment.
To manually upload recommendations, you will need to create a CSV file that contains the following information for each client in the set:
IsReview (FALSE for Standard Projects, TRUE for Review/NoChange Projects
IsBrokerage (Always FALSE)
ExternalVariables (Number of ExternalVariables included in row. 0 if none)
Client Number/ID
Provider (Broker or Trade Destination e.g. Open Markets, Salesforce. Must be provided for each trade)
Investment Code/Ticker
ExternalID (SubAccountNumber e.g. Open Markets account number)
ExternalName (SubAccountName - only for use in advice documents. Leave blank if non required)
ExternalVariables: Any client-specific number or text that you need to incorporate into the advice document.
*Indented section optionally repeats for each trade
Once you have created the CSV file, you can upload it into your project in Portfolio Cloud. The system will then process the information and update the recommendations and trades accordingly.
For a discussion on the use of External Variables, refer to
The CSV should take the following format
If ‘Review (No Change)’ Project: IsReview = true
If ‘Standard’ Project: IsReview.= false
If ‘Brokerage’ variable is being used: IsBrokerage: = true
If ‘Brokerage’ variable is not being used: IsBrokerage: = false
Number of external variables used for account: 0-10
Account Number
If multiple trade providers are used they can be specified in this column. If no trade provider, leave BLANK
Instrument Code
Recommended trade units: + for buys, - for sells
SubAccountNumber If no SubAccountNumber, leave blank
SubAccountName If no SubAccountName, leave blank
Any client-specific number or text that you need to incorporate into the advice document.
For a list of upload examples, refer to and
Upload the CSV File
To upload the recommendations, create a new Project Create a New Project or enter an existing project.
Click on on the Upload button in the header row
Screen Shot 2020-05-13 at 3.43.05 pm.png
This will launch the upload trades dialogue. Click in the Choose File button.
Screen Shot 2020-05-13 at 3.43.58 pm.png
This will launch a standard browse file dialogue. Select the file you wish to upload, then click OPEN
You will then return to the Trade Upload dialogue. To finish uploading the CSV, click the Upload Trades button
Screen Shot 2020-05-13 at 3.48.18 pm.png
When the upload completes successfully, the results message will be shown in he dialog box. Clock Close to return to the project page.
Screen Shot 2020-05-13 at 3.47.05 pm.png
When you return to the project page, the new recommendation should be shown in the advice table. If may take a few minutes for all the trade to be uploaded.
Screen Shot 2020-05-13 at 3.50.09 pm.png
Upload Errors
If there are any errors in the CSV file upload will fail, and the errors will be reported in the Trade Upload Dialogue.
Screen Shot 2020-05-13 at 3.59.27 pm.png
The error message will indicate which account numbers have issues.
Common reasons for failed up upload include
No account number exists
No brokerage exists but IsBrokerage was set to true
Number in ExternalVariables is different to the number of external variables in the row
Code does not exist
Units is not a number

